Description
This position supports the work of the Y, a leading nonprofit, charitable organization committed to strengthening community through youth development, healthy living, and social responsibility. In addition to providing leadership to the Membership Services Team, the Membership Coordinator is responsible for membership growth, recruitment, retention, and recovery. We are a strong team that thrives with an all‑hands‑on‑deck approach, therefore the individual in this role will be cross‑trained to assist in other departments as needed.
